“The Bullet's Kiss: Part Three”

In "The Bullet's Kiss: Part Three," Greg Hettinger walks free after serving time, determined to clear his name and rebuild his life—only to find that the past isn't ready to let him go. Written by Duane Swierczynski and illustrated with sharp, moody precision by Michael Gaydos, this issue deepens the mystery of a man caught between justice and vengeance. The cover by Francesco Francavilla captures the tension with a striking, noir-inspired image.

Full plot ⚠ may contain spoilers

▸ Reveal full plot — may contain spoilers

Greg Hettinger is released from jail and decides to clean up his act, with a new mission to find the man who framed him for drug possession.
